Avesta Housing, Portland, ME $500,000 AHP Award for West End Phase II

According to the NLIHC, there are nearly 42,000 extremely low-income households in Maine, a state with the oldest population and the country's oldest housing stock. Avesta Housing, serving Portland, Maine, is already under construction for a 64-unit affordable apartment building, the West End Apartments I, with completion expected in early 2021. In 2019, Avesta was awarded $800,000 in low-income federal housing tax credits. In 2020, Avesta received a $500,000 AHP Award from the FHLBank Atlanta (sponsored by Community Housing Capital (CHC)) for West End II, a 52-unit property adjacent to its sister property, West End I.

The West End Apartments I & II will add 90 subsidized and 26 market-rate apartments to a struggling affordable housing market in South Portland's West End neighborhood. Funding sources for West End II included a $750,000 equity bridge loan from CHC, an AHP loan and grant from the FLHBank Boston, subsidies from Maine Housing, a construction loan, and tax increment financing. This new urban village's location is part of an overall zoning change approved by the Portland City Council in 2017 to promote neighborhoods that encourage outdoor activities like walking, biking, and hiking.

The new West End II construction project will consist of 52 mixed-income units, including 32 units restricted to households at or below 50% of the area median income (AMI), eight apartments restricted to households at or below 60% AMI, and 16 handicapped-accessible apartments. Twelve apartments will be market-rate. Located just minutes from major employment centers like downtown Portland, the Maine Mall, and the Portland Jetport, West End I & II will have easy access to public transportation and Interstate 295. The development also provides excellent proximity to many amenities, including grocery stores, playgrounds, the Portland Trail Network, pharmacies, and a variety of other retail options.

Avesta Housing is a nonprofit affordable housing provider with 45+ years of experience in southern Maine and New Hampshire. Headquartered in Portland, Maine, Avesta currently has 98 properties, 2,700 apartments, and two assisted-living facilities in its portfolio.
